/* This CSS file is created for you to create or override any of the existing CSS styles used in this theme */

body { background: url(images/rar_bk3.jpg) top center repeat-y #000;}
#header	{background: #fff url(images/rar_hd_bak.jpg) top right repeat-y; border-bottom:0;padding: 0 0 8px 0;width: 960px; margin: 0 auto; }
#branding {width: 968px; margin: 0 auto; }
.logo	{margin: 5px 0 0 0px; }
/*.logo {background: url(images/logo-star.gif) no-repeat #015a9a;  max-width: 590px; height:75px;float: left; margin:0 0 0 0; padding: 20px 0 0 0px; } 
h1.blog-name, h2.blog-description {margin-left:85px;}*/

h1.blog-name a, span.blog-name a {display:block;cursor:pointer;width:368px;height:88px;background:url(images/rar_hd_logo.gif);text-indent:-9999px;padding:0;margin:0}
/*span.blog-name {display:block;}*/
h2.blog-description, span.blog-description {display:none;}
#searchbar {padding-right:20px;}
#searchbar input {color:#666;}

.sf-menu li li a, .sf-menu li:hover li a, .sf-menu li li:hover li a, .sf-menu li li li:hover li a, .sf-menu li li li li:hover li a {background-color:#fff;}

.sf-menu li:hover, .sf-menu li.sfHover,
.sf-menu a:focus, .sf-menu a:hover, .sf-menu a:active {
	background:#fff;
	outline:0;
}

.sf-menu a {color:#015a9a;}
.sf-menu li.page_item a:hover, .sf-menu li.cat-item a:hover {text-decoration:underline;}
.sf-menu li.page_item li a:hover, .sf-menu li.cat-item li a:hover {text-decoration:none;}
ul.sf-menu li ul.children {float:right;background-image:url(http://rightarmresource.com/wp-content/themes/arras-theme/images/techblue/content-bg.jpg);background-position:center top;background-repeat:repeat-x;border:1px solid #ccc;background-color:#fff;}
ul.sf-menu li.cat-item-18 ul.children {width:300px;}
ul.sf-menu li ul.children li {border:0;background-image:none;}
ul.sf-menu li ul.children li a {border:0;background-image:none;background-color: transparent;}
ul.sf-menu li ul.children li a:hover {background:#FFFFFF url(http://rightarmresource.com/wp-content/themes/arras-theme/images/techblue/feed-title.jpg) repeat-x scroll center top;}

/* Home page static area */	
div#statichome {margin-bottom:10px;}
div#statichome img {padding:0px 7px 5px 0;float:left;}
#statichome table {float:left;border-collapse:separate;border-top:0px;border-left:0px;border-right:1px solid #02629e;border-bottom:1px solid #02629e;width:211px;padding:0;margin:0 7px 0 0;}
#statichome table td {border:0px;border-width:0px;background:#FFF;padding:0px;margin:0;vertical-align:top;}
#statichome table td img {padding:0px;}

	td.socialbtn {width:70px;}
	td.socialbtn p {padding:0;margin:0;}
	td.socialbtn p a {background-image: url(images/rar_hm-social.jpg);background-repeat:no-repeat;display:block;width:70px;text-indent:-9999px;padding:0;margin:0}
	td.socialbtn p a.fbk {background-position: 0 0;height:51px;}
	td.socialbtn p a.fbk:hover {background-position: 0 -152px;}
	td.socialbtn p a.twt {background-position: 0 -50px;height:46px;}
	td.socialbtn p a.twt:hover {background-position: 0 -354px;}
	td.socialbtn p a.lkn {background-position: 0 -95px;height:49px;}
	td.socialbtn p a.lkn:hover {background-position: 0 -551px;}
	
	.clear {clear:both;padding-bottom:5px;}

/* Custom Artist page head */	
div.artbio {line-height: 1em; color: #333; font-size: 12px; margin: 0 10px 0 0; padding: 7px 10px; background: #fff; border: 1px solid #CCC;border-bottom:0px;}
div.artbio img {float:left;margin:0 8px 5px 0;}


h1.cathd {font-size:18px;color:#015a9a;}
body.archive h1.feed-title {background-color:#fff;background-position:center bottom;}

/* Home News Section, Search and Archive */
body.home ul.posts-quick img, body.archive ul.posts-quick img, body.search ul.posts-quick img {width:125px;height:66px;}
body.home ul.posts-quick span.entry-comments, body.archive ul.posts-quick span.entry-comments, body.search ul.posts-quick span.entry-comments {display:none;}
body.home ul.posts-quick h3, body.archive ul.posts-quick h3, body.search ul.posts-quick h3 {font-size:13px;padding-bottom:0px;margin-bottom:0;}
body.home ul.posts-quick div.entry-summary, body.archive ul.posts-quick div.entry-summary, body.search ul.posts-quick div.entry-summary {font-size:11px;line-height:15px;}
body.home ul.posts-quick p.quick-read-more, body.archive ul.posts-quick p.quick-read-more, body.search ul.posts-quick p.quick-read-more {margin:0;padding:5px 0 2px 0;}

.posts-quick .published	{ color: #000;}
.posts-quick span.entry-meta
{width:135px;background:none; height: 15px;
font-weight: normal; }
.posts-quick .entry-meta	{ margin: 66px 0 0 -141px; }
body.archive .posts-quick .published {margin-left:20px;}
body.archive .posts-quick .entry-thumbnails {
float:right;
}
body.archive ul.posts-quick img {margin-left:8px;margin-right:0;}

/* Underlines */
body.page h2.entry-title, body.single h1.entry-title {border-bottom:1px solid #015a9a;}
body.single div.entry-photo {margin-bottom:5px;border-bottom:1px solid #ccc;}
/* Posts */


/* Artist Archive page */
.arthistory h3 {margin:10px 0 5px 0;padding:0 0 0 0;clear:left;}
/*.arthistory ul {margin:0 0 20px 0;padding:0;line-height:18px;}
.arthistory li {font-size:11px;
display: inline;
list-style-type: none;
padding-right: 20px;
} */
/* Client page style */
div.clientlist {background-image:none;}
.clientlist ul, .arthistory ul {float:left;}
.arthistory ul {width:165px;}
.arthistory a {text-decoration:none;}
.arthistory a:hover {text-decoration:underline;}

div.page ul.postbar li.postcomment {display:none;}